Salmon and Bean Pasta Bake

This Salmon and Bean Pasta Bake combines the heartiness of traditional pasta dishes with the nutritious benefits of kidney beans, fresh vegetables, and tinned salmon. The dish is baked to perfection, allowing the flavors of garlic, onions, and broccoli to meld beautifully, creating a satisfying meal that is both comforting and healthy. It's a great option for a quick weeknight dinner, packed with protein and fiber.

Recipe Times & Servings
Prep Time:
15 minutes
Cook Time:
30 minutes
Servings:
4 servings

Ingredients:

  • 200g pasta (any shape you prefer)
  • 1 can kidney be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 can tinned salmon, drained and flaked
  • 2 carrots, diced
  • 1 cup broccoli florets
  • 1 onion, finely ch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 cup grated cheese (optional, for topping)

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F).
  2. Cook the pasta according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
  3.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té until transl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
  4. Add the minced garlic and diced carrots to the skillet. Cook for another 3-4 minutes until the carrots begin to soften.
  5. Stir in the broccoli florets and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es until bright green.
  6. In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ked pasta, kidney beans, flaked salmon, sautéed vegetables, oregano, salt, and pepper. Mix well.
  7. Transfer the mixture into a greased baking dish. If using, sprinkle the grated cheese on top.
  8.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until heated through and the cheese is bubbly and golden.
  9. Allow to cool slightly before serving. Enjoy your comforting Salmon and Bean Pasta Bake!
